Year one

Seven Hills Realty Trust Year one decreased by 61.3% to $57.48M in Q1 2026 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ric grew by 25.0%, from $45.99M to $57.48M. Over 3 years (FY 2022 to FY 2025), Year one shows a downward trend with a -10.3% CAGR.
